Energy Solution Manager
Austria, Vienna
Main Responsibilities
- Design integrated PV + ESS solutions, including system architecture, component sizing, PCS selection, battery configuration, EMS design, and grid-interaction strategy.
- Develop PV and ESS solution proposals for utility-scale, ensuring technical competitiveness and compliance with local standards.
- Support sales activities through customer workshops, technical presentations, Q&A sessions, and preparation of bidding documents for PV and ESS projects.
- Conduct technical feasibility studies including energy yield simulation, charge/discharge strategy analysis, safety assessment, cycle-life evaluation, and ROI calculations.
- Provide technical support during project delivery, including battery commissioning, PCS debugging, EMS configuration, and troubleshooting of PV + ESS systems.
- Track and analyze PV and ESS industry trends, policies, technologies, and competitive solutions; propose enhancement ideas for Huawei’s smart energy portfolio.
- Deliver technical training for partners, EPCs, integrators, and internal teams on both PV and ESS systems.

Professional Knowledge
- Core Technical Theory of PV and ESS: Master PV generation principles, module parameters/selection; ESS core (battery charging/discharging, life, safety); PCS topology/regulation/grid adaptation and EMS control/scheduling/coordination.
- PV+ESS Integrated Design & Simulation: Master integrated architecture design; conduct scenario-based configuration (module/battery/PCS/EMS); proficient in mainstream tools for generation simulation, strategy optimization and performance verification.
- Industry Standards & Compliance: Master key domestic, know grid-connection requirements; understand regional policies to ensure compliance.
Techno-Economic Analysis & Feasibility: Master techno-economic evaluation; grasp generation prediction, LCC analysis; calculate ROI/payback period; conduct comprehensive evaluation considering prices/subsidies to support optimization.
